In about an hour, we built and deployed “Pixel Golf,” a 2D physics game running on the Avalanche blockchain.In about an hour, we built and deployed “Pixel Golf,” a 2D physics game running on the Avalanche blockchain.

I Built an On-Chain Video Game in the Time It Takes to Watch Netflix

In the time it takes to watch a Netflix episode, I built a complete, on-chain video game.

I’m a solo developer. My only partner was an AI copilot. And in about an hour, we built and deployed “Pixel Golf,” a 2D physics game running on the Avalanche blockchain.

This isn’t just a fun experiment. It’s a blueprint for the future of game distribution — a future where “buying” a game means you actually, truly own it.

The Problem with “Ownership”

For the last two decades, we’ve been trained to accept a new definition of “ownership.” When you buy a game on Steam, you aren’t buying a game. You’re buying a license to play that game, indefinitely, at the sole discretion of the platform.

If that platform decides to revoke your access, your game is gone. If that platform disappears tomorrow, your entire library vanishes into the digital ether.

You own nothing. You’re just a long-term renter.

I believe there’s a better way. When you buy a Griggs game, you own it. Period. My little golf game is the proof.

The 60-Minute “Pixel Golf” Challenge

My project goal was simple: create a fun, 2D pixel-art golf game. The core loop? Set your power, set your angle, and try to get the ball in the hole in the fewest strokes.

The “team” was just me and my AI copilot, Gemini. The “stack” was just as lean:

  1. index.html: The user interface and Web3 logic.
  2. game.js: The core physics engine.
  3. PixelGolfPass.sol: A Solidity smart contract for the NFT.

Here’s how the hour broke down.

Minutes 0–10: Forging the “Game Pass”

We didn’t start with the game. We started with ownership.

Before writing a single line of game logic, we deployed a smart contract to the Avalanche blockchain. This contract, PixelGolfPass.sol, is an ERC-721 NFT. It does one simple thing: it lets a user mint a unique "Game Pass" for 0.1 AVAX.

This NFT isn’t a cosmetic item. It’s not a skin. It is the key. It represents your permanent, irrevocable, and sellable right to play this game.

Minutes 10–25: Building the “Blockchain Bouncer”

With our contract live on the mainnet, we built the front-end in index.html. This wasn't just a UI; it was the bridge to the blockchain.

\ \ Using Ethers.js, we wired up the “Connect Wallet” button. The moment you connect, the JavaScript performs a crucial check:

const hasMinted = await contract.hasMinted(yourWalletAddress);

Instead of checking a private database on my server, the game asks the blockchain itself if you are a valid owner. If the hasMinted function returns true, the game UI appears. If false, the "Mint" button appears.

The game doesn’t care who you are. It only cares about what you own.

Minutes 25–50: The Physics & The Bugs

This is where the AI copilot shined. We hammered out the entire physics engine in game.js. We coded the projectile motion (gravity, velocity), collision detection, and ground friction.

And, of course, we hit bugs.

First, the game got stuck in an infinite “loading” loop. We quickly diagnosed that the ball’s physics were “jittering” on the ground, never truly stopping, so the game loop never told the UI the turn was over. The fix? A simple check to “settle” the ball’s velocity to zero when it was moving slowly.

Next, you could roll directly over the hole without winning. The win condition was too precise. We debugged it together, widening the hole’s detection radius to make the game feel fair and fun.

Minutes 50–60: Integration and Final Polish

With the bugs squashed, we finished the loop. We hooked the “Launch” button to the physics engine and had the engine call back to the UI to update the score. We added the “Course Complete” screen, which pops up after the 5th hole, ready to submit your final score.

In one hour, we had a fully functional, token-gated game.

This is True Digital Ownership

Here’s the “aha” moment.

The game itself — the index.html and game.js files—is just a set of static files. They can be hosted anywhere. On GitHub Pages, on a personal server, or even on decentralized storage like Arweave.

If my website goes down tomorrow, it doesn’t matter.

Anyone can re-upload those static files to a new URL. And when you navigate to that new site and connect your wallet, it will still check the immutable Avalanche blockchain, see your Game Pass NFT, and grant you access.

Your ownership isn’t tied to my website. It’s tied to your wallet.

You can’t be banned. Your game can’t be revoked. You can even sell your Game Pass on the open market, just like you’d sell a physical game cartridge.

This isn’t just a simple golf game. It’s a new model. The AI-assisted workflow made it possible to build in an hour, but the on-chain ownership model makes it revolutionary. This is what the future of gaming looks like.

Want to play it? \n https://www.damiangriggs.com/web3/web3-games

\

Market Opportunity
SQUID MEME Logo
SQUID MEME Price(GAME)
$32.2169
$32.2169$32.2169
-0.29%
USD
SQUID MEME (GAME) Live Price Chart
Disclaimer: The articles reposted on this site are sourced from public platforms and are provided for informational purposes only. They do not necessarily reflect the views of MEXC. All rights remain with the original authors. If you believe any content infringes on third-party rights, please contact service@support.mexc.com for removal. MEXC makes no guarantees regarding the accuracy, completeness, or timeliness of the content and is not responsible for any actions taken based on the information provided. The content does not constitute financial, legal, or other professional advice, nor should it be considered a recommendation or endorsement by MEXC.

You May Also Like

American Bitcoin’s $5B Nasdaq Debut Puts Trump-Backed Miner in Crypto Spotlight

American Bitcoin’s $5B Nasdaq Debut Puts Trump-Backed Miner in Crypto Spotlight

The post American Bitcoin’s $5B Nasdaq Debut Puts Trump-Backed Miner in Crypto Spotlight appeared on BitcoinEthereumNews.com. Key Takeaways: American Bitcoin (ABTC) surged nearly 85% on its Nasdaq debut, briefly reaching a $5B valuation. The Trump family, alongside Hut 8 Mining, controls 98% of the newly merged crypto-mining entity. Eric Trump called Bitcoin “modern-day gold,” predicting it could reach $1 million per coin. American Bitcoin, a fast-rising crypto mining firm with strong political and institutional backing, has officially entered Wall Street. After merging with Gryphon Digital Mining, the company made its Nasdaq debut under the ticker ABTC, instantly drawing global attention to both its stock performance and its bold vision for Bitcoin’s future. Read More: Trump-Backed Crypto Firm Eyes Asia for Bold Bitcoin Expansion Nasdaq Debut: An Explosive First Day ABTC’s first day of trading proved as dramatic as expected. Shares surged almost 85% at the open, touching a peak of $14 before settling at lower levels by the close. That initial spike valued the company around $5 billion, positioning it as one of 2025’s most-watched listings. At the last session, ABTC has been trading at $7.28 per share, which is a small positive 2.97% per day. Although the price has decelerated since opening highs, analysts note that the company has been off to a strong start and early investor activity is a hard-to-find feat in a newly-launched crypto mining business. According to market watchers, the listing comes at a time of new momentum in the digital asset markets. With Bitcoin trading above $110,000 this quarter, American Bitcoin’s entry comes at a time when both institutional investors and retail traders are showing heightened interest in exposure to Bitcoin-linked equities. Ownership Structure: Trump Family and Hut 8 at the Helm Its management and ownership set up has increased the visibility of the company. The Trump family and the Canadian mining giant Hut 8 Mining jointly own 98 percent…
Share
BitcoinEthereumNews2025/09/18 01:33
Gold continues to hit new highs. How to invest in gold in the crypto market?

Gold continues to hit new highs. How to invest in gold in the crypto market?

As Bitcoin encounters a "value winter", real-world gold is recasting the iron curtain of value on the blockchain.
Share
PANews2025/04/14 17:12
Exclusive interview with Smokey The Bera, co-founder of Berachain: How the innovative PoL public chain solves the liquidity problem and may be launched in a few months

Exclusive interview with Smokey The Bera, co-founder of Berachain: How the innovative PoL public chain solves the liquidity problem and may be launched in a few months

Recently, PANews interviewed Smokey The Bera, co-founder of Berachain, to unravel the background of the establishment of this anonymous project, Berachain's PoL mechanism, the latest developments, and answered widely concerned topics such as airdrop expectations and new opportunities in the DeFi field.
Share
PANews2024/07/03 13:00